Seriously, these are healthy enough to feel good eating and giving them. Dates are a fantastic source of dietary fiber, as well as essential minerals potassium and magnesium (think proper nerve and heart function). Almond butter adds some nice protein so these treats digest more slowly than the average bon-bon or truffle, staving off any blood sugar spikes. And we all know that high-quality chocolate is packed with antioxidants, because the first hormonal human to discover said fact made sure to splash it across the net (and I bow down in gratitude).
